#68dac2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#68dac2 is composed of 40.8% red, 85.5% green and 76.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 52.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 11% yellow and 14.5% black. It has a hue angle of 167.4 degrees, a saturation of 60.6% and a lightness of 63.1%. #68dac2 color hex could be obtained by blending #d0ffff with #00b585. Closest websafe color is: #66cccc.

#68dac2 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#68dac2 has RGB values of R:104, G:218, B:194 and CMYK values of C:0.52, M:0, Y:0.11, K:0.15. Its decimal value is 6871746.
